Recreational Activities
Martin Park and MLK Jr. Pool: Directly across the street, Martin Park provides a playground, sports fields, and open green spaces. Adjacent to the park, the MLK Jr. Pool is Charleston's only public 50-meter pool, open year-round for swimming and aquatic classes.
King Street Shopping: A short walk brings you to King Street, one of America's top shopping destinations, featuring a mix of boutiques, antique shops, art galleries, and a vibrant dining scene.
Cultural Attractions
Historic Sites: Explore Charleston's rich history with visits to landmarks like Rainbow Row, a series of colorful historic houses, and The Battery, a picturesque promenade lined with antebellum mansions overlooking the harbor.
Waterfront Park: Enjoy the scenic views and the iconic Pineapple Fountain at Waterfront Park, a perfect spot for relaxation and leisurely walks.
